What do Bitrix24 automation rules and triggers do well?

This is the built-in automation mechanism, tied to pipeline stages. It is configured without a developer and works out of the box. These strengths come straight from the official documentation.

  • A rule runs on its own when an item lands on a stage: send an email, create a task, generate a document, notify a manager, reassign the owner.
  • A trigger moves the deal forward by itself. It watches customer actions and changes in items — a link clicked in an email, an inbound call, an invoice paid — and moves the CRM item to the stage where the trigger is configured.
  • Every rule has three built-in settings: execution order (sequential or independent), timing (immediately, after a delay, or a set time before an event) and a condition — for example, deal amount.
  • Customer communication is native: send an email, place a call that reads out text or plays a recording, send a messenger or social network message, send an SMS, invite the customer to a Telegram chat.
  • The same mechanism works across four tools: CRM, tasks, Bitrix24 Sign and digital workplaces.
  • There is a built-in debugger: the scenario runs on a test deal with an action log and skipped pauses. In the official plan comparison table, the row for the CRM deal rule debugger is marked as available on every plan, including Free.
  • Automation is available from day one: the Free plan lists 5 in the automation rules and triggers row; paid plans from Basic upward are marked as available.
  • The mechanism is extensible: an application can register its own rule via bizproc.robot.add and its own trigger via crm.automation.trigger.add, and return the result to the process via bizproc.event.send.

For heavier scenarios there are two neighbouring tools: business processes with the visual Designer (Professional and Enterprise) and RPA for simple internal approvals outside CRM.

Where does the stage-based model run out of room?

These are not complaints about the product — they are the boundaries of the model and the caveats Bitrix24 documents itself. Worth knowing before you build quality control on top of automation rules.

  • The model is stage-based by design: a rule runs when an item lands on the stage where it is configured, and a trigger moves the item to the stage where it is configured. A scenario that cannot be expressed as movement between stages cannot be expressed here.
  • Rules live inside their own container: in tasks they have to be configured separately for each project, and in CRM they are set per entity and per stage. There is no portal-wide rule set.
  • A condition is evaluated at the moment the rule fires. If an external system fills fields in gradually through webhooks, the rule may read a field before anything has been written to it.
  • Editing a scenario does not reach instances that are already running — they finish under the parameters that applied when they started.
  • Several rules changing the same data at once can conflict with each other. That is a separate entry in the official list of reasons automation did not work.
  • Communication rules depend on connected channels: email needs a mailbox connected for the responsible employee, calls need telephony, SMS needs a chosen provider, a Telegram invitation needs a connected Telegram channel.
  • Business processes, the Business Process Designer and editing rules through the constructor are available only on Professional and Enterprise. The Free plan has 5 automations and a single sales pipeline.
  • Taking inventory means opening the interface: bizproc.robot.list returns rules registered by the application, and crm.automation.trigger.list returns triggers added by the application. Anything assembled by hand in the interface is not listed by those methods.

The official table publishes no numeric ceiling on rules or runs for paid plans — it simply marks them as available. The only published number is 5, on the Free plan.

What can an automation rule not see by its nature?

A rule reacts to an event: a stage changed, a field changed, a call arrived. Four things in a sales floor are not events at all — they live in the text of the conversation and in the recording of the call.

  • The meaning of a message. To a rule, a message is a fact, not content. Omnia Lab reads the text: a message that consists entirely of "ok" or "thanks" closes the conversation, while the same word inside a live sentence does not, and the response timer keeps running. Marketplace service notices do not open an SLA and do not distort response time, and any live text from the customer wins.
  • Whether a human actually replied. Triggers catch an inbound call, an email being read, an invoice being paid, a field changing — a human reply is not on that list. Omnia Lab measures time to the first real contact and escalates on a ladder: 5, 15 and 17 minutes to the shared sales chat, 10 minutes to the rep in private, 20 minutes to the head of sales. A reply, a call or the "no reply needed" button closes the measurement and clears every reminder. At night escalation stages are cancelled, not pushed to the morning.
  • A promise made in plain text. "I'll call you at four", "I'll send the quote by end of day" — to a rule this is an ordinary message. Omnia Lab turns it into a task with a deadline: a private ping 30 minutes before it is due, another private ping 15 minutes after it is missed with "Done" and "Postpone" buttons, and only after an hour does it reach the shared chat. Before every ping the system rereads the conversation: if the promise is already kept, the task closes itself. Customer promises work the same way — "I'll look at it in an hour" becomes a task due at the customer's own time plus 30 minutes.
  • Whether a closure was justified. A rule will execute everything configured on the Lost stage and will never ask why the deal was lost. Omnia Lab reviews every closure to spam or lost against the whole history — chat, comments, the card, the transcript of a recent call — and returns an unjustified closure to work, no more than once per deal, with a decision log. During a mass cleanup of the pipeline (more than 30 closures in 2 hours) returns are muted: the system does not argue with a deliberate human decision.

Can first-response control be built with automation rules?
Partly. A rule can remind you on a timer from a stage, and a trigger can react to an inbound call, an email being read, an invoice being paid or a field changing. But "the rep actually answered the customer" is not on that event list, so in a stage-based model closing that measurement has to be tied to a stage change or to a manual action.
How many automation rules does the free Bitrix24 plan include?
The plan comparison table shows 5 in the automation rules and triggers row for the Free column, and that plan includes a single sales pipeline. Basic and above are marked as available with no number given.
How do I verify that a rule actually ran?
Bitrix24 has a debugger: the scenario runs on a test deal with an action log and pauses skipped, available to employees with the right to change CRM settings. On Professional and Enterprise, business process events are written to a testing log kept for 7 days.
Why can't I export the list of rules through the API?
The REST list methods return only the application's own objects: bizproc.robot.list returns rules registered by the application, and crm.automation.trigger.list returns triggers added by the application. Anything assembled by hand in the interface will not appear, so inventory is done in the interface.
